Gradle 7.0: Type 'PopulateECRCredentials' property 'credFileDirectory' is missing an input or output annotation

Create issue
Issue #26 closed
Pavel Grigorenko created an issue

The only thing I did was update Gradle from 6.8.3 to 7.0 and DockerPushImage task started failing with:

  - Type 'PopulateECRCredentials' property 'credentialFile' is missing an input or output annotation.

    Reason: A property without annotation isn't considered during up-to-date checking.

    Possible solutions:
      1. Add an input or output annotation.
      2. Mark it as @Internal.

    Please refer to https://docs.gradle.org/7.0/userguide/validation_problems.html#missing_annotation for more details about this problem.

Comments (8)

  1. Kostiantyn Shchepanovskyi

    This issue is a huge blocker for us. Basically it prevents us from moving to Java 16, as it requires Gradle 7.0.

  2. Log in to comment